The West has many useful natural resources such as trees, potatoes, pineapples, salt, and oil . Deposits of many minerals, including copper, gold, and silver, are found within the Rocky Mountains, making the West an excellent source for minerals.

What is the main resource in the West?

The West is known for its wealthy supply of mineral resources such as oil, coal, lead, silver, gold, and copper . Many of these minerals are found in the Rocky Mountains. The West is the center of the timber industry. Much of the wood products used in the U.S. come from the West (lumber, cardboard, paper, books).

What is the most important natural resource in the West?

The most important natural resource in the West is the Pacific Ocean . Fishing is an important industry up and down the coast. There are many important ports along the Pacific Ocean.

What are some renewable resources in the West Region?

Nearly all available renewable energy technologies are well suited for deployment in the West, including solar, wind, hydro, biomass, geothermal, marine, and waste energy , as well as biofuels.

What crops are grown in the West region?

The climate, characterized by low humidi- ty and many cloud-free days, is ideal for some irrigated and nonirrigated crops such as wheat, sorghum, cotton, potatoes, barley , and special- ty crops such as fruits, nuts, grapes, and table vegetables.

What are the landforms in the West Region?

The Coast Ranges, the Sierra Nevadas, the Cascade Range, and the Rocky Mountains are all found in the West region. Several valleys lie in between the Coast Ranges, the Sierra Nevada Mountains, and the Cascade Mountains. Two of the valleys, Central Valley and Willamette Valley, are covered with deep, rich soil.

How does the West Region make money?

During the Gold Rush days, farming and mining were the West Region’s major industries. ... Today, farming and mining are still done. You will also find manufacturing, technology, and tourism in the region. The region’s natural resources and climate are very important to its industries.
